The proposed resolution, introduced by Chairman Phil Mendelson, seeks to declare an emergency regarding the closure of a cul-de-sac located in Square 4350, adjacent to Lot 0006 and bordered by Douglas Street, N.E., in Ward 5. The resolution emphasizes the urgent need for this closure to facilitate the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ority's (WMATA) Bladensburg Bus Garage Reconstruction Project. This project aims to expand the parking capacity for Metro buses and enhance infrastructure to support WMATA's Zero Emission Bus Transition Plan, ultimately increasing employee parking availability.
To expedite the process, the resolution allows for the emergency legislation to be enacted after a single reading, ensuring that the project can move forward without unnecessary delays. The Council plans to mark up permanent legislation related to this matter on October 7, 2025, with a first reading scheduled for the same day. The immediate effect of this resolution is crucial for the timely execution of the reconstruction project and the associated improvements in public transportation infrastructure.
